Can Netflix win over Taylor Swift? The streaming giant, which has over 300 million subscribers worldwide, changed the game in ...
8h
Us Weekly on MSNNetflix CEO Isn't Ruling Out Taylor Swift Performing at Christmas NFL GameCould Taylor Swift perform on Christmas Day before headlining a Super Bowl stage? It might just be a goal for Netflix CEO Ted 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results